Why Every Vehicle Should Have a QR Code for Emergency Contacts
Emergencies on the road can happen at any time, and having immediate access to crucial information can save lives. A practical and innovative solution to this problem is attaching QR codes to vehicles for emergency contacts. This technology ensures that vital details are accessible during accidents or breakdowns, streamlining response efforts. Here’s why every vehicle should be equipped with a QR code for emergency contacts.

1. Quick Access to Critical Information
QR codes provide a fast and efficient way to access essential details. By simply scanning the code, responders can retrieve emergency contact numbers, medical history, allergy information, and more. This instant access allows timely and informed assistance.

2. Facilitates Communication During Crises
When victims of a collision are unable to speak due to injury, a QR code serves as a vital communication tool. It allows first responders to contact family members or healthcare providers promptly, ensuring that the right information reaches the right people.
________________________________________
3. Speeds Up Medical Decisions
For paramedics and emergency medical services (EMS), time is often of the essence. QR codes containing medical details, such as pre-existing conditions or ongoing treatments, help responders deliver appropriate care faster, reducing the risk of complications.
________________________________________
4. Simple to Create and Update
Implementing QR codes is cost-effective and user-friendly. Once generated, these codes can be updated digitally without requiring changes to the physical sticker. This flexibility makes them a sustainable safety measure.
________________________________________
5. Reduces Dependence on Paper Documents
Carrying physical documents like insurance and medical records isn’t always feasible. A QR code digitizes and securely stores this information, making it readily available in emergencies without the need for paper copies.

How to Add a QR Code to Your Vehicle
1. Generate Your QR Code: Use a trusted QR code generator to create a code linked to a secure webpage or document containing your emergency details.
2. Include Essential Details: The QR code should contain emergency contacts, medical conditions, allergies, and insurance information.
3. Position the Code Clearly: Attach the QR code to a visible area of your vehicle, such as the windshield, dashboard, or driver’s door.
4. Update as Needed: Regularly review and update the linked information to keep it accurate and reliable.
